You are standing on the ground at the origin of a coordinate system. An airplane flies over you with constant velocity parallel to the x axis and at a fixed height of 7.60 x 103 m. At time t = 0 the airplane is directly above you, so that the vector leading from you to it is P0 = (7.60 x 103 m) ˆj. At t" 30.0 s the position vector leading from you to the airplane is P30 = (8.04 x 103 m) ˆi + (7.60 x 103 m) ˆj. Determine the magnitude and orientation of the airplane’s position vector at t = 45.0 s.
